Transaction 04ba6697fbaa8ae8f197838615794161873e561ca59d44018321cb1a56bbaaca
1 Input
1 Output
-
04ba6697fbaa8ae8f197838615794161873e561ca59d44018321cb1a56bbaaca:0
- value
- 21435022
- script pubkey
- OP_0 OP_PUSHBYTES_20 7afc0ae69558162c59d9b1e177d910a3335a5675
- address
- bc1q0t7q4e54tqtzckwek8sh0kgs5ve454n4ft3h83